作为数字支付领域的领军者,微信支付一直以其便捷、安全和可靠而著称。无论是线上商城还是线下实体店铺,微信支付都成为了消费者和商家的首选。在日常运营中,我们不可避免地会遇到一些接口错误问题,这可能会影响到支付流程,甚至影响到交易的完成。
让我们了解一下微信支付接口错误可能出现的常见原因。一些最常见的问题包括网络连接问题、参数设置错误、账户权限不足、以及平台更新导致的接口变动等。在日常运营中,这些问题可能会给商家和开发者带来不小的困扰,但幸运的是,大多数问题都是可以通过正确的方法来解决的。
在遇到微信支付接口错误时,第一步是冷静下来,不要慌张。您可以尝试以下几种解决方案来解决问题:
检查网络连接:网络连接不稳定是导致接口错误的常见原因之一。确保您的设备连接到稳定的网络,并且没有阻止微信支付接口通信的防火墙设置。
检查参数设置:在发起支付请求时,确保您传递的参数是正确的、完整的,并且符合微信支付接口的要求。常见的参数错误包括金额格式错误、商户号错误、以及签名错误等。
检查账户权限:如果您是开发者或商户,在遇到接口错误时,首先检查您的账户是否具有足够的权限来执行所需的操作。有时,接口错误可能是由于权限不足而导致的。
关注平台更新:微信支付平台会不时进行更新和优化,这可能会导致接口发生变动。在遇到接口错误时,您可以前往微信支付官方网站或开发者文档查看最新的接口规范和变动说明,以确保您的接口调用代码与最新规范保持一致。
通过以上方法,大多数微信支付接口错误都可以迅速解决。但如果您在尝试以上方法后仍然无法解决问题,那么可能需要进一步排查或联系微信支付客服进行帮助。
除了以上常见的解决方案外,还有一些更高级的技巧可以帮助您更快速地定位和解决微信支付接口错误。以下是一些进阶技巧:
日志记录与分析:在接口错误发生时,及时记录相关的错误信息,并进行详细的分析。通过查看日志,您可能会发现一些隐藏的问题或异常情况,从而更快地解决接口错误。
调试工具的使用:微信支付提供了丰富的调试工具和接口测试平台,您可以利用这些工具来模拟支付请求、查看接口调用日志,以及分析请求和响应数据,帮助您快速定位和解决接口错误。
与其他开发者交流:在开发者社区或论坛上与其他开发者交流经验,分享解决方案。有时,其他开发者可能遇到过类似的问题,并且有着宝贵的经验和建议,这对于解决接口错误问题非常有帮助。
定期更新代码:微信支付接口规范和平台功能会不断更新和优化,及时更新您的代码可以避免因为接口变动而导致的错误。建议定期检查微信支付官方网站或开发者文档,了解最新的接口规范和变动说明,并相应地更新您的代码。
微信支付接口错误虽然可能会给商家和开发者带来一些困扰,但只要您保持冷静、耐心,并采取正确的解决方法,大多数问题都是可以迅速解决的。不断学习和积累经验,加强对微信支付接口的理解和掌握,也是避免和解决接口错误的关键。
微信支付接口申请容易,政策优惠,欢迎咨询微信支付接口的申请资料。
发表回复